Texas Longhorns Secure 30-6 Victory Over UTSA Ahead of SEC Schedule
WHY IT MATTERS
The Longhorns' performance ahead of their SEC opener sets the stage for a crucial test against Tennessee, with the outcome potentially impacting their season trajectory.
What happened
Arch Manning, the star quarterback of the top-ranked Texas Longhorns, threw two touchdown passes in the early stages of the game but struggled for the remainder of the contest. Despite this, Texas secured a 30-6 victory over UTSA, improving their record to 3-0. The Longhorns' defense played a crucial role in the win, allowing just 143 total yards and keeping the Roadrunners out of the end zone.
Manning finished the night with 164 passing yards, completing 17 of 33 passes, but took several hard hits throughout the game. He left the game about halfway through the fourth quarter.
Texas will face a tougher challenge next week as they open Southeastern Conference play against No. 15 Tennessee in Knoxville.
